American Airlines has announced they will no longer accept firearms in checked luggage on flights to Europe and Asia. This will have a dramatic effect on those travelling to Africa to hunt. Many flights to Africa transit Europe, and if you use a code share partner like British Airways to fly to Africa and you are using American Airlines as your domestic carrier you are out of luck.
